| OLD | NEW |
| 1 if (this.importScripts) { | 1 if (this.importScripts) { |
| 2 importScripts('../../../resources/js-test.js'); | 2 importScripts('../../../resources/js-test.js'); |
| 3 importScripts('shared.js'); | 3 importScripts('shared.js'); |
| 4 } | 4 } |
| 5 | 5 |
| 6 description("Test IndexedDB's basics."); | 6 description("Test IndexedDB's basics."); |
| 7 | 7 |
| 8 function test() | 8 function test() |
| 9 { | 9 { |
| 10 removeVendorPrefixes(); | |
| 11 request = evalAndLog("indexedDB.open('basics')"); | 10 request = evalAndLog("indexedDB.open('basics')"); |
| 12 shouldBeTrue("'result' in request"); | 11 shouldBeTrue("'result' in request"); |
| 13 evalAndExpectException("request.result", "DOMException.INVALID_STATE_ERR", "
'InvalidStateError'"); | 12 evalAndExpectException("request.result", "DOMException.INVALID_STATE_ERR", "
'InvalidStateError'"); |
| 14 shouldBeTrue("'error' in request"); | 13 shouldBeTrue("'error' in request"); |
| 15 evalAndExpectException("request.error", "DOMException.INVALID_STATE_ERR", "'
InvalidStateError'"); | 14 evalAndExpectException("request.error", "DOMException.INVALID_STATE_ERR", "'
InvalidStateError'"); |
| 16 shouldBeTrue("'source' in request"); | 15 shouldBeTrue("'source' in request"); |
| 17 shouldBeNull("request.source"); | 16 shouldBeNull("request.source"); |
| 18 shouldBeTrue("'transaction' in request"); | 17 shouldBeTrue("'transaction' in request"); |
| 19 shouldBeNull("request.transaction"); | 18 shouldBeNull("request.transaction"); |
| 20 shouldBeTrue("'readyState' in request"); | 19 shouldBeTrue("'readyState' in request"); |
| (...skipping 19 matching lines...) Expand all Loading... |
| 40 shouldBeNull("event.target.transaction"); | 39 shouldBeNull("event.target.transaction"); |
| 41 shouldBeTrue("'readyState' in request"); | 40 shouldBeTrue("'readyState' in request"); |
| 42 shouldBeEqualToString("event.target.readyState", "done"); | 41 shouldBeEqualToString("event.target.readyState", "done"); |
| 43 shouldBeTrue("'onsuccess' in event.target"); | 42 shouldBeTrue("'onsuccess' in event.target"); |
| 44 shouldBeTrue("'onerror' in event.target"); | 43 shouldBeTrue("'onerror' in event.target"); |
| 45 | 44 |
| 46 finishJSTest(); | 45 finishJSTest(); |
| 47 } | 46 } |
| 48 | 47 |
| 49 test(); | 48 test(); |
| OLD | NEW |